Peter Obi a political scam – Labour Party spokesman rejects ADC coalition talks

The National Publicity Secretary of the Labour Party, Abayomi Arabambi, has dismissed the recent statement by Peter Obi, the party’s 2023 presidential candidate, in which he pledged to serve only one term if elected in 2027.

According to reports, Peter Obi, during a live session on X Spaces on Sunday night, declared his intention to run for president in 2027.

Speaking to supporters both in Nigeria and the diaspora, Obi stated he was willing to serve a single four-year term if elected and expressed openness to coalition talks, emphasising that such alliances must be centred on solving Nigeria’s fundamental challenges.

On Tuesday, the National Coordinator for the Obidient Movement Worldwide, Yunusa Tanko, disclosed that Obi has submitted his single-tenure proposal to the opposition coalition for consideration.

Speaking on Wednesday on a current affairs programme on Eagle 102.5 FM, Ilese Ijebu, monitored by DAILY POST in Abeokuta, Arabambi described Obi’s claim as “falsehood laced with desperation.”

He said, “That statement about running for just one term is deceptive. In Nigeria’s history, has any president ever truly committed to one term? After a year or two, you’ll start hearing chants of ‘four more years.’ Peter Obi’s promise is inconsistent and dishonest.

“The likes of Obi and his co-farmers, we know what they came to do but for him to claim he’s going to spend just a term is a statement made out of falsehood [and] is impossible.

“He said he will fix Nigeria in two years, a man that cannot even fix Labour Party in six months. He came to make sure our party was an embodiment of his institutional slavery. Where’s the empirical track of his words?”

The Labour Party spokesperson further criticised Obi’s political history, accusing him of destabilising the party after joining in 2022.

“The guy came to scam us in Labour and I will never deviate because we know the intricacies that happened in the party. He moved from APGA to PDP, then came to Labour Party. He’s a political scam. When the time comes, we will expose him,” he added.

Arabambi, however, downplayed the significance of the coalition, describing it as “selfish and personal,” restating that the party would not form alliances with those who, in his opinion, contributed to the current state of Nigeria.

“We are not considering any coalition. The likes of Tinubu, Atiku, and even Obi have brought this country to its knees since 2015. They are birds of the same feather. They should all get out of Nigeria’s political system,” he stated.
